41/71 as a percentage is 57.75%. This tells us that the fraction is a little more than half of a whole. When you see 57.75%, you can picture just over five out of every ten parts.
The fraction 41/71 is already in its simplest form because 41 and 71 share no common divisors other than 1. It represents 41 equal pieces out of a total of 71 pieces. In everyday life, such a ratio might show up in statistics, like the proportion of students who passed a test.
Because the percentage is rounded to two decimal places, the exact value might be a tiny bit higher or lower, but 57.75% is close enough for most practical uses. It’s a handy way to compare the fraction with other percentages you might encounter.
